Vital Foundational Concrete Elements for Every Project

A solid foundation is vital for any construction project, serving as the cornerstone of structural integrity. It delivers stability, limits settlement, and ensures the longevity of the structure. Proper foundation design begins with an assessment of soil conditions, load requirements, and environmental factors. General contractors must emphasize the selection of high-quality materials, as they directly impact the durability and performance of the foundation. The choice between various foundation types—such as slab, pier, or crawl space—depends on the specific project needs and local building codes. Additionally, thorough attention to detail during the pouring and curing process is critical to avoid future complications. Effective communication with engineers and architects during the planning phase improves the foundation's alignment with overall project goals. By prioritizing these aspects, general contractors can ensure a robust foundation that supports the entire structure, securing the investment and ensuring safety for years to come.

Refined Concrete Surfaces

While many flooring options exist, polished concrete surfaces emerge as a remarkable option for residential and commercial spaces alike. These surfaces offer a sleek, modern aesthetic, improving the overall design and utility of any space. This technique requires grinding and polishing the concrete to create a high-shine finish, which not only enhances the visual appeal but also boosts durability. Polished concrete is resistant to stains and spills, making it a practical option for high-traffic environments. Additionally, it reflects light, contributing to energy efficiency by reducing the need for artificial lighting. Being a highly flexible choice, polished concrete can be personalized using a range of aggregates and finishes, permitting general contractors to meet diverse client expectations while producing superior results.

Concrete Staining Options

What solutions are there for upgrading concrete visual appeal? Stained concrete provides a versatile solution for transforming dull surfaces into vibrant, eye-catching designs. Experienced contractors can deliver a wide range of staining options, like acid stains, which chemically bond with the concrete to generate vibrant, translucent tones, along with water-based stains that deliver an expanded range of colors and more straightforward application.

These stains are available in a variety of application methods, enabling distinctive patterns and finishes that elevate the aesthetic quality of both interior and exterior areas. Moreover, integrating stains alongside other decorative techniques, including engraving or stamping, can result in complex and visually striking patterns. With the addition of stained concrete choices, contractors can fulfill client requirements for exceptional, beautiful settings while maintaining structural integrity and ease of maintenance.

Routine Cleaning Schedule

Maintaining a regular cleaning schedule is crucial for maintaining the quality and look of concrete surfaces. Consistent upkeep prevents the collection of dirt, grime, and stains that may compromise the material over time. Professionals should suggest pressure washing as the main approach for thorough cleaning, making sure debris is properly eliminated without harming the surface. Additionally, using a mild detergent can enhance cleaning effectiveness, particularly for oil or grease stains. Frequency of cleaning may vary based on environmental conditions and usage, but a biannual schedule is often ideal. Including sweeping and spot treatments in routine care can help extend the durability of concrete surfaces even further. In the end, a committed cleaning routine plays a significant role in the lasting quality and visual appeal of concrete installations.

Proper Sealing Techniques

Effective sealing techniques are essential for protecting the lifespan and aesthetics of concrete surfaces. Contractors should stress the significance of selecting the right sealant based on the environment and intended use of the concrete. Acrylic, epoxy, and polyurethane coatings each deliver specific strengths, such as resistance to UV rays or enhanced flexibility. Application should be performed under ideal weather conditions, ensuring surfaces are clean and dry. Sufficient curing time is important; a sealant should be given time to set in line with manufacturer recommendations. Moreover, contractors need to guide clients on care routines, such as scheduled reapplications, to enhance long-term performance. Overall, utilizing proper sealing approaches not only boosts the appearance of concrete but also defends it against moisture, staining, and other destructive forces.

Timely Repairs Needed

Prompt repairs are crucial for maintaining concrete surfaces in optimal condition and avoiding additional deterioration. Fractures, chips, and surface deterioration can develop into major problems if left unattended. General contractors ought to regularly copyrightine concrete for indicators of deterioration, such as discoloration or uneven surfaces, which may indicate underlying problems. Employing suitable repair materials is critical; epoxy injections provide a reliable solution for sealing cracks, while resurfacing compounds can restore worn areas. Additionally, timely maintenance actions like filling joints and applying protective sealants contribute to longevity. By addressing these repairs promptly, contractors boost the appearance of the concrete while also prolonging its service life, securing client satisfaction and preventing costly repairs down the line. Innovative Concrete Solutions for Sustainable Construction

As the construction industry increasingly prioritizes sustainability, cutting-edge concrete solutions are being developed to address both environmental and structural requirements. One significant advancement is the development of eco-friendly concrete mixes that incorporate recycled materials, such as crushed glass or industrial byproducts, reducing reliance on virgin resources. In addition, autonomous concrete repair technologies are rising in prominence, employing bacteria or specialized polymers capable of sealing cracks on their own, thus prolonging the material's durability while lowering upkeep expenses.

Furthermore, permeable concrete is being utilized to manage stormwater effectively, permitting water to penetrate the surface and decrease runoff. This not only reduces flooding but also encourages groundwater replenishment. To conclude, the adoption of carbon capture technologies in concrete production provides a compelling opportunity for lowering greenhouse gas emissions. These innovative approaches not only enhance structural integrity but also contribute to a more sustainable construction future, meeting the increasing need for environmentally conscious construction practices.

Frequently Asked Questions

What Are the Common Costs Involved in Concrete Services?

Typical costs associated with concrete services vary widely, usually spanning from $3 to $15 per square foot. Variables that impact pricing consist of labor, materials, location, project complexity, and any extra features or finishes needed.

How Long Does It Take for Concrete to Cure Properly?

Concrete commonly needs around 28 days to cure properly, reaching its maximum strength. That said, initial setting times may differ, often allowing for light foot traffic within 24 to 48 hours after being poured, subject to surrounding conditions.

How Does Concrete Production Affect the Environment?

Concrete production significantly impacts greenhouse gas emissions, the exhaustion of raw materials, and habitat destruction. The extraction of raw materials, high-energy production processes, and the movement of materials intensify environmental concerns, emphasizing the critical demand for sustainable practices in the construction industry.

Is It Possible to Pour Concrete in Cold Weather?

Yes, concrete can be poured in cold weather, but certain precautions must be taken. Employing additives, insulating blankets, and heated enclosures helps secure proper curing and prevents freezing, which could compromise the concrete's overall strength and durability.

What Forms of Reinforcement Are Employed in Concrete Structures?

Concrete structures typically utilize steel reinforcement bars, welded wire fabric, and fiber additives. Such materials increase tensile performance, limit crack formation, and elevate structural durability, providing reliable stability and extended service life under a range of environmental factors and load pressures.
